When comparing trading costs for Lesotho traders, Vantage has a clear edge on raw spreads, starting from 0.0 pips on its Razor account, but charges a $3 commission per lot per side. XM Group’s Standard account offers spreads from 1.0 pips with no commission, while its Zero account starts from 0.6 pips plus a $5 commission. For a Lesotho trader executing 10 standard lots per month on EUR/USD, Vantage’s total cost is roughly $60 (spread + commission), while XM Group’s Zero account totals around $110. However, XM Group’s Micro account is ideal for smaller volumes with lower risk. Overall, Vantage is more cost-efficient for active traders, while XM Group suits beginners or lower-frequency traders in Lesotho.

Both XM Group and Vantage offer the industry-standard M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5) platforms, which are popular among Lesotho traders for their advanced charting, automated trading via Expert Advisors (EAs), and mobile access. XM Group also provides its own XM WebTrader for browser-based trading, which is useful for traders without installation access. Vantage adds TradingView integration, appealing to traders who prefer advanced charting tools. For Lesotho traders with limited internet bandwidth, both platforms offer mobile apps that work well on 3G/4G networks. Overall, both brokers deliver robust platform options, but Vantage’s TradingView support gives it a slight edge for technical analysis enthusiasts.

Both XM Group and Vantage off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Lesotho Muslim traders who wish to trade without earning or paying interest (riba). XM Group provides swap-free accounts on all account types, but charges an admin fee after 30 days if positions are held overnight. Vantage offers swap-free accounts on its Standard STP and Razor accounts with no time limit, making it more suitable for long-term position traders. For Lesotho traders who hold trades for extended periods, Vantage’s policy is more favorable. However, XM Group’s swap-free option is still competitive for shorter-term traders. Both brokers require a simple request to activate the Islamic account, and no additional documentation is needed beyond standard account verification.
